Anyway, it uses the stamp set Cute as a Bug, which retires in a few days.  Print pattern is the background stamp; cardstock is green galore, gable green (the lighter green), pixie pink (aka Dora the Explorer pink) and whisper white cardstock.  Green brad anchors the word window punch "tag".  Image is coloured with stampin’ write markers.

I needed a quick birthday card!  This uses the birthday wheel from one of the new hostess sets – All About Occasions bundle, which includes a 4 piece stamp set (great for tags & small cards), a birthday jumbo wheel & a thank you jumbo wheel.  Demonstrators were allowed to preorder certain hostess sets that will be featured in the new fall/winter collections catalogue.  These will be available for hostesses to earn starting July 1st.  The jumbo birthday wheel is in pretty in pink ink and mounted onto cool caribbean cardstock (disappearing at the end of the month).  Wrapped some pink grosgrain (it’s for a girl, can you tell?!)around the image & mounted with stampin’ dimensionals onto my card base.  I added the butterfly from A Greeting for All Reasons (retiring at the end of June) and added dazzling diamonds glitter with my 2 way glue pen.  Unfortunately I had a bit of a gluing mishap, thus the "splats" of glitter….but I think it still works….
